Upbeat Di Resta targets points
Sahara Force India
Paul di Resta expressed his satisfaction after qualifying in 12th place for the Japanese Grand Prix.
Di Resta has not scored a point since the British Grand Prix in June but believes he is in a good position to end his barren run at Suzuka.
'Given where we started yesterday, I think we should be pretty happy with P12,' he said.
'Slowly but surely we’ve made the car more drivable and in qualifying it felt quite good. The overnight efforts of everyone at the track and back at the factory have helped dial the car into the circuit.'
